    "Trade talk involving Artest is heating up" - Sac Bee

    Any takers?

    Denver (for Nene) is the only team mentioned that has had recent negotiations with Kings GM Geoff Petrie, but it looks like they are about to be shopping our TruWarier more actively. Nothing active on the Heat or Knick talks apparently either. But this was the state of things according to Amick.
    "Perhaps knowing that making one public statement is easier than making 29 phone calls to each of the league's general managers, Petrie made it clear that the player known as the one of the best two-way talents in the game is as available as ever if the deal is right."

      The answer is contained within the same article:

      "Artest has been on an erratic spell of late, with his public displays including the on-floor tirade at coach Reggie Theus while playing Detroit on Jan. 18 and his bizarre antics at Utah on Friday that led to his ejection after two technicals. Privately, sources close to the team said he has exploded at Theus numerous times in recent weeks while growing frustrated with the season and the first-year coach.When asked if Artest's recent behavior increased his desire to move Artest, Petrie said, "Not really. No, I don't really think so. I really don't. I know he started to lose it in that Utah game a little bit, but he was fine in Seattle and (Wednesday night). He's volatile.""
